Maruti Suzuki unveiled the Ignis concept, a compact SUV in hatchback stance, at the Auto Expo 2016. The company also confirmed the production version launch in the festive season. It seems India's largest car-maker by volume has already begun testing of the car.

A picture from Gaadiwaadi.com shows two Ignis models disguised in black colour. The report says one car features a 1.2-litre VTVT petrol engine and while the other has a 1.3-litre MultiJet diesel unit. Both engines power many of of Maruti Suzuki's currently selling cars.

The Ignis will be the third model to be sold through Maruti's Nexa premium dealerships. Unveiled at the 44th Tokyo Motor Show last year, Maruti Suzuki Ignis measures 3,700 mm in length, 1,660 mm in width and 1,595 mm in height. It has a ground clearance of 180 mm and comes with a wheelbase of 2,435 mm. Maruti Suzuki Ignis, which is expected to come to the Indian market with 95 percent localisation, is likely to get a price tag between Rs 4.8 lakh and Rs 6.8 lakh. When launched, the Ignis will rival Mahindra KUV100 and Ford EcoSport.

As for styling, the Iginis is expected to house features like projector headlights, outside rear-view mirrors with turn indicators, 18-inch alloy wheels, rear mounted spoiler and LED headlights. Other features expected include touchscreen infotainment system, ABS (anti-lock braking system) with EBD (electronic brake distribution) and airbags.
